Diamondbacks vs Braves: Brandon Pfaadt Dominates as Arizona Wins 2-0

The Diamondbacks vs Braves matchup delivered a pitching showcase on Friday, August 14, 2026, with Arizona earning a 2-0 victory over Atlanta. Brandon Pfaadt was the standout performer, throwing seven scoreless innings to keep the Braves’ offense off the scoreboard.

Diamondbacks vs Braves: Brandon Pfaadt Shines

Brandon Pfaadt delivered one of his best performances of the season. The Arizona right-hander allowed only two hits, walked nobody and struck out seven across seven shutout innings.

Pfaadt needed just 87 pitches to complete his outing and consistently kept Atlanta’s hitters from generating quality contact. His efficient performance allowed the Diamondbacks to take control of the game while limiting the pressure on their bullpen.

His recent form has been particularly impressive. Since returning to Arizona’s rotation from Triple-A Reno on June 30, Pfaadt has gone 7-0 with a 1.15 ERA over nine starts.

The outing against Atlanta also extended his scoreless streak to 32.2 innings, dating back to July 23.

Dbacks – Braves Game Recap

Arizona opened the scoring in the first inning. Geraldo Perdomo went 4-for-5 and scored after Gabriel Moreno grounded out, giving the Diamondbacks an early 1-0 lead.

Atlanta struggled to answer. The Braves managed only three hits during the game and could not produce a run against Pfaadt.

Chris Sale gave the Braves a strong outing of his own. Sale struck out nine and surrendered only one run over six innings, continuing his impressive stretch of limiting opponents to three or fewer runs.

Arizona eventually added insurance in the ninth inning when Tim Tawa launched a solo home run. Brandyn Garcia then finished the game with a scoreless ninth inning, striking out two batters.

Brandon Pfaadt’s Recent Dominance

Pfaadt’s performance against Atlanta continued an exceptional run. His seven scoreless innings extended his streak without an earned run to more than 32 innings.

His command has been a major part of his success. Against the Braves, he did not issue a walk and avoided long innings, preventing Atlanta from building momentum.

Pfaadt also effectively mixed his changeup and curveball with his other pitches, giving Atlanta’s hitters a difficult matchup throughout the evening.

What the Diamondbacks vs Braves Result Means

The 2-0 victory gave Arizona an important win as the Diamondbacks continue their push through the 2026 season. The victory improved Arizona’s record to 65-58 and ended a two-game losing streak.

Atlanta dropped to 73-49 after being shut out, although Sale’s performance gave the Braves plenty of encouragement heading into the remainder of the series.

The Dbacks – Braves series continues Saturday, August 15, with Eduardo Rodríguez scheduled to start for Arizona against Grant Holmes of Atlanta.
